WebbFast contact form. The fast track and the multi track. Cases in the county courts are assigned to one of three tracks: the Multi Track, the Fast Track or the Small Claims Track. This guidance tells you about the sort of cases that are likely to be allocated to the fast track and the multi-track, and about how cases will be handled in those tracks. Webb3 jan. 2024 · Where a claim is allocated to the Small Claims track and then subsequently reallocated to another track, the costs set out above will cease to apply after the claim has been re-allocated and the cost rules for Fast Track or Multi-Track cases (dependant on the allocated track) will apply from the date of re-allocation (Rule 27.15).

Multi-track. This is generally the appropriate track for claims where the financial value of the case is more than £25,000 and the trial is expected to last longer than one day. These claims can be heard in either the High Court or the County Court.
Webb4 nov. 2024 · Small claims track This is generally the appropriate track for claims where the financial value of the case is below £10,000. Once the defence has been filed, the court provisionally allocates a claim, based primarily on its value, and directs the parties to file and serve directions questionnaires.
